Subject: Handover — GPU profiling tooling

Hi all,

I'm rotating off release duty for VramScope, so here's the short version. The profiler samples GPU memory every 50 ms and ships flamegraphs to the Kestrel dashboard. Releases go out Thursdays; run the soak test on the Moorfield bench rig first, or Priya will haunt you. Changelog lives in docs/handover.md. One gotcha: the driver shim must match the agent version exactly. To push a release you'll need the signing key, which is below.

signing key of fajop-tahop = bky9_qdL6xeDv7

Handover note — Brightkit component library versioning

Welcome aboard. Brightkit is the shared component library used by both the Fennel dashboard and the Orlo mobile shell. We publish on a two-week cadence; majors require sign-off from Priya before release. The trickiest part is the version-resolution service, which pins consumers to compatible ranges and handles deprecation warnings. Do not edit its settings by hand — change the manifest and redeploy. For reference, its current configuration is shown below.

settings of fafog-haduf:
ZORIX_PIN=4648
ZORIX_METRICS_HOST=metrics.zorix.paliqsys.corp
ZORIX_LOG_LEVEL=info
ZORIX_TENANT=druix

### Runbook: Report export timezone mismatches (Glimmerfield)

If a customer reports that exported totals differ from the dashboard, check whether their report schedule predates the March cutover — older schedules still render in server-local time rather than the account timezone. Re-saving the schedule fixes it. Before escalating, confirm the export worker is running with the expected timezone settings shown below.

config for kadup-kajog:
[raldor]
host = raldor.tolvaqworks.internal
user = raldor_svc
database = raldor_prod

Ticket #2208 — SQL lint vault sealed itself again

Hey, quick one before you approve the Brindlewood migration PR: the lint-rules vault (where we keep the sqlcheck config for the Otterby schemas) locked after three failed syncs. Nothing scary — the new uppercase-keywords rule tripped the validator. Can you unseal it so CI stops whining? The prompt on the Harrow console wants the recovery passphrase, which appears just below.

vault phrase of tajeg-tageg = pelix-druix-holius-briael-zorwyn-frawyn-fraox-norok-drueth-aldiel